The execution of the above works of Sanitary improvement
necessitated the submitting to the Board plans for 106 premises.
Since my last annual report the Sanitary works in connection with
the following schools have been finished:—
Bromley Hall Road Board Schools.
Oban Street Board Schools, unfinished, (nearly completed).
Alton Street Board Schools.
St. Leonard's Road Board Schools.

The works in connection with above schools are finished, the
Primitive Chapel and Sunday Schools, Chrisp Street, were found to
be in fair condition at the time of my inspection.
All the Cow and Slaughter-houses were inspected before the time
for the renewal of the annual licenses in October, and found in fair
condition.
Licensed Slaughterhouses 2
Licensed Cowhouses 4
